DBeaver 配置 SQL Server 的方案

DBeaver 是一款开源的数据库工具,支持多种类型的数据库,包括 SQL Server。在本篇文章中,我们将详细说明如何配置 DBeaver 以连接 SQL Server,并解决连接过程中的常见问题。

1. 下载与安装 DBeaver

首先,你需要下载并安装 DBeaver。你可以前往 DBeaver 的[官方网站](

2. 创建新连接

安装完成后,启动 DBeaver。接下来,我们需要创建一个新的数据库连接:

  1. 在 DBeaver 主界面,点击左上角的 "新建连接" 按钮(或者使用快捷键 Ctrl+N)。
  2. 在弹出的窗口中,选择 "SQL Server" 作为连接类型。

![DBeaver 创建连接示例](

3. 配置连接属性

在配置连接属性的窗口中,你需要填写以下信息:

  • 主机:SQL Server 所在的服务器地址,例如 localhost 或者指定的 IP 地址。
  • 端口:默认的 SQL Server 端口是 1433
  • 数据库:你想要连接的数据库名称。
  • 用户密码:你用于连接数据库的凭证。

一个示例连接配置如下表所示:

属性
主机 localhost
端口 1433
数据库 my_database
用户 my_user
密码 my_password

配置完成后,点击 "测试连接" 按钮,确保连接有效。

4. 解决常见问题

在配置 SQL Server 连接时,可能会遇到一些问题。下面是几种常见的错误及其解决方案:

(1) 连接超时错误

如果连接超时,请确认以下几点:

  • SQL Server 服务已经启动。
  • 防火墙设置允许 SQL Server 的端口(1433)通过。
  • 网络连接正常,无环境问题。

(2) 认证失败

如果收到认证失败的错误,检查以下内容:

  • 用户名和密码是否输入正确。
  • 用户是否具有访问指定数据库的权限。
  • SQL Server 认证模式是否设置为允许 SQL Server 和 Windows 认证混合模式(混合模式可以在 SQL Server Management Studio 中设置)。

5. 使用 DBeaver 执行 SQL 查询

连接成功后,你可以使用 SQL 编辑器执行查询。以下是一个简单的查询示例,查询 Employees 表中的所有记录:

SELECT * FROM Employees;

输入以上 SQL 语句后,点击执行按钮,结果会在下方的结果窗口中显示。

6. 序列图

为了更清晰地了解连接过程的步骤,我们用序列图表示 DBeaver 与 SQL Server 之间的连接关系。

sequenceDiagram
    participant DBeaver
    participant SQLServer
    DBeaver->>SQLServer: 发送连接请求
    SQLServer-->>DBeaver: 返回连接确认
    DBeaver->>SQLServer: 发送查询请求
    SQLServer-->>DBeaver: 返回查询结果

这个序列图展示了 DBeaver 如何与 SQL Server 进行基本的通信流程。

结尾

通过以上步骤,你已成功配置 DBeaver 连接 SQL Server,并能够执行 SQL 查询。当遇到连接问题时,参考提供的解决方案,通常可以找到问题所在。DBeaver 提供了一个友好的界面和强大的功能,能够极大地提升你的数据库管理效率。希望本篇文章能够帮助你顺利完成 DBeaver 的配置,并在使用中取得良好的体验!如果有更深入的问题或需求,可以参考 DBeaver 的[官方文档](